Scope
GB 15308-2025 is the English-translated version of 泡沫灭火剂.
GB 15308 is the product standard for foam extinguishing agents - the concentrates proportioned into water to fight flammable liquid fires. It sets the classification, codes and model designation, the requirements for the concentrate and for the foam it produces (expansion ratio, drainage time, extinguishing and burnback performance, freezing point, viscosity, sediment, corrosion and storage stability), the test methods including the small-scale fire test in Annex A, the inspection rules and the packaging and instructions for use. The 2025 revision arrives as the industry moves away from fluorinated surfactants, which is the change that matters commercially. Issued on 1 August 2025, in force since 1 August 2026, replacing GB 15308-2006. 3 Terms and definitions
The following terms and definitions apply to this document.
3.1 characteristic values The physical and chemical performance valves of the foam concentrate and the foam solution that are provided by the manufacturer. 3.2 25% drainage time The time required to separate the liquid equivalent to 25% of the foam mass from the foam.
3.3 expansion The ratio of the volume of foam to the volume of the foam solution that constitutes the foam.
3.4 low expansion foam concentrate Foam concentrate with an expansion of 1~20.
3.5 medium expansion foam concentrate Foam concentrate with an expansion of 21~200.
3.6 high expansion foam concentrate Foam concentrate with an expansion greater than 200.
3.7 foam A collection of air-filled bubbles formed from a foam solution. NOTE. Foam is also called fire-fighting foam.
3.8 foam concentrate A concentrated liquid that forms a foam solution when mixed with water at an appropriate concentration. NOTE. Foam concentrate is also called foam concentrate liquid.
3.9 foam solution A solution made of foam concentrate and water at a specified concentration.
3.19 spreading coefficient A measure of the ability of one liquid to spread freely on the surface of another liquid.
3.20 lowest temperature for use The temperature that is 5 °C above the freezing point.
4 Classifications, codes and model specifications
4.1 Classifications and codes The main classifications and codes of foam concentrates are shown in Table 1.
4.2 Model specifications The method for compiling the model specifications of foam extinguishing agents is as follows: EXAMPLE 1.3% (P, -10 °C) means a protein foam extinguishing agent with a mixing ratio of 3%, a freezing point of -10 °C, and is suitable for fresh water. EXAMPLE 2.6% (AFFF, -15 °C)-Seawater resistant means an aqueous film-forming foam extinguishing agent with a mixing ratio of 6%, a freezing point of -15 °C, and is suitable for both fresh water and seawater.
5.1 General requirements
5.1.1 If the foam concentrate is suitable for use with seawater, the concentration of the foam solution prepared with seawater shall be the same as that prepared with fresh water.
5.1.2 The raw materials and production process of the foam concentrate shall meet the requirements of human health, safety and environmental protection.
5.1.3 Foam concentrates of different model specifications or produced by different processes shall not be mixed when filling fire extinguishers, fire trucks and fire extinguishing systems are filled or when fire extinguishing equipment is repaired.

6.1 Sampling and temperature treatment
6.1.1 Sampling Whether sampling from one container or from multiple containers, stir thoroughly. Fill the storage container with the sample and seal it.
6.1.2 Temperature treatment The foam concentrate shall be temperature-treated according to the following steps.
a) If the manufacturer declares that the sample is not affected by freeze-thaw, the sample shall first be subjected to four freeze-thaw cycles according to 6.3, and then processed according to 6.1.2b);
b) Place the sample sealed in the container in an environment at (60±2) °C for 7 days, and then place it in an environment at (20±5) °C for 1 day;
c) If the manufacturer declares that the sample is subject to freeze-thaw, only process the sample according to 6.1.2b).
6.2 Freezing point
6.2.1 Instruments and equipment Test instruments and equipment shall meet the following requirements.
a) Freezing point test equipment. with a temperature control accuracy of ±1 °C;
b) Platinum resistor. T100, with an accuracy of ±0.1 °C and an outer diameter of
c) Digital temperature display instrument. The resolution is 0.1 °C.
6.2.2 Test steps The freezing point test for the foam concentrate shall be carried out according to the following steps.
a) Turn on the freezing point test equipment and stabilize the temperature of the cold chamber at (10±1) °C below the freezing point of the sample;
b) Inject the sample into the dry, clean inner tube so that the liquid level is approximately 50 mm;
c) Use a cork or rubber stopper to fix the platinum resistor in the center of the inner tube, with the lower end of the platinum resistor 10 mm away from the sample liquid surface;
d) Place the inner tube containing the sample into the outer tube, with the distance from the bottom of the inner tube to the bottom of the outer tube not exceeding 10 mm. Then place the outer tube into the cold chamber, with the depth of the outer tube in the cold chamber not less than 100 mm.
e) Start the test, and the equipment automatically records the temperature-time curve;
f) When the sample is completely frozen, read the temperature at the platform of the curve as the freezing point;
g) Repeat the test and take the higher value of the two test results with a difference of no more than 1 °C as the measurement result.
6.3 Freeze and thaw resistance
6.3.1 Instruments and equipment Low-temperature box. It can meet the temperature requirements of 6.3.2b).
6.3.2 Test steps The foam concentrate shall be tested for freeze and thaw resistance properties according to the following steps.
a) Determine the freezing point of the sample according to 6.2.2;
b) Adjust the temperature of the low-temperature box to (10±1) °C below the freezing point of the sample;
c) Place the sample that meets the requirements of
6.1.1 into a plastic or glass container, seal it, and place it in a low-temperature box. Keep it at the temperature specified in 6.3.2b) for 24 hours. After freezing, remove the sample and place it at a room temperature of (20±5) °C for (24~96) hours. Repeat this process three more times, for a total of four freeze-thaw cycles.
d) Observe the sample for stratification and heterogeneity.
